Looks like Yeager's has a 1 ounce dated bar: http://www.yeagerspouredsilver.com/index.php?main_page=product_info&cPath=1&products_id=107
SilverTowne also does a few minted ones they date. Generic stuff, so not sure how the quality is. And if you're interested in vintage stuff, there are a ton of dated 1-oz minted bars out there from the '70s. US Assay bars (minted version) are dated 1981. Nice piece of history. Sometimes you can find them in good condition for a decent price.
